Description

Guitar Monitor is a Max for Live Device, where you can display the scales and chords on a Guitar Fretboard. You can view the basic chords within a given scale and the shapes on the guitar fretboard.

Features

- shows the basic Chords of the selected Scale

- visualisation on the Fretboard, of the Scales, the Chords and Chordshapes

- Monitor incomming Midi Notes

- make different Chord Shapes visible

- Select Notes on the Fretboard to visualize them on a Pianokeyboard.

- visualize Scales, Chords and Custom Notes on the Fretboard.

- map able via Midi Controller to select a Chord within a given Scale and to select the Chord Shape
